Building Access — Bike Cage & Parking Gates

Night crew: the bike cage at Thornefield Court is round the back, past the bins. The parking gates drop to keypad-only mode after 20:00, so don't bother waving your badge at the reader — it's asleep. Same code works for both the cage and the gates. Punch in the code below.

door code, yagap-bahof: bdg-O-05

FAQ: Why did Broomster close my branch? The bot sweeps branches with no commits in 90 days and no open merge request. To exempt a branch, add the keep label. Config lives in the Tidings repo; changes deploy nightly. Do not disable the sweeper globally — it also prunes the CI cache. If Broomster's service account gets locked after a failed rotation, recovery requires the passphrase maintained by this team, recorded immediately below for continuity.

vault phrase of tajef-tafog = istox-sorax-zorox-casok-holox-kelix-weneth-drueth-casion

For each upstream team, confirm that per-client quotas are defined in the gateway config and not hardcoded in services. Verify burst allowances, the 429 response format, and that retry-after headers are populated. Test that the global circuit breaker engages when aggregate traffic exceeds the documented ceiling. Record evidence in the audit workbook, including config snapshots and load-test output. If anything is unclear as you work through this item, contact the accountable engineer named below.

account owner for fajep-yagef: Kasix Eliiel

# --- Connection Pooling (Tidewren service) ---
# Pool sizing: max 20 connections per worker, 4 workers per host.
# Anything above 80 total connections trips the Fennelgate proxy's
# per-tenant cap and requests start queueing hard.
# Idle timeout is 300s; keep it — shorter values caused reconnect
# storms during the March load test. Do not enable statement-level
# pooling; the ORM relies on session temp tables.
# Reviewers: flag any PR that raises max pool size without a load test.
# The pool dials the primary using the connection string below.

warehouse DSN: mssql://rusdor_svc:0FSWCn9@db-951a.paliqforge.local:5432/ulawyn